The Super-Duper ExhibitThe Magic House, St. Louis
Children’s Museum Sid the Science Kid will take your child on
scientific adventures through hands-on, interactive activities. Sid the Science Kid is based on the award-winning PBS Kids TV Series, and in collaboration with the Jim Henson Company

Stingrays at Caribbean Cove presented by Mercy
St. Louis Zoo The stingrays are back!
Watch, touch, and even feed these gentle and elegant ocean creatures as they glide through the water in their tropical saltwater habitat.

First Bank Sea Lion ShowsSt. Louis Zoo
Every Saturday and Sunday the sea lions at the zoo will keep you entertained with their flipper walks, ball balancing, and splashing! Visit the new Lichtenstein Sea Lion Arena and see these magnificient creatures in action!
St. Louis Storytelling Festival This four day festival held in
various locations around St. Louis and St. Charles County, showcases both national and regional storytellers, and is appropriate for all ages! Watch as your child gets captivated by these talented and animated storytellers.

Gateway Arch Riverboat Sightseeing Cruise
Climb aboard the Becky Thatcher or the Tom Sawyer Riverboats and cruise down the mighty Mississippi river! Enjoy the experience with your little one as you learn about this history of St. Louis. Reservations are required. Call (877) 982-1410 or visit
